Gordon Ramsay extends the usage of P2D globally

2nd February 2026 – Long-standing client the Gordon Ramsay Group has expanded the adoption of P2D for all restaurants globally. The empire, which spans nearly 100 restaurants worldwide, has undergone major restructuring to unify its operations under a single global entity—supported by renewed private‑equity investment aimed at accelerating global expansion. This consolidation enables the group to scale faster, innovate more aggressively, and explore new operational models across continents. With expansion planned across Asia, Europe, the Middle East, and the US, the group’s digital ecosystem will play a vital role in ensuring operational consistency and efficiency worldwide.

And closer to home, the group has significantly expanded its presence at the 22 Bishopsgate skyscraper in the City of London, which has become a central hub for the group’s UK growth. The site already includes Lucky Cat, Restaurant Gordon Ramsay High, and a cookery school, with around 200 jobs already created at this location. A new Bread Street Kitchen is also confirmed to open in the first half of 2026 at 22 Bishopsgate. This expansion alone will create around 150 new UK jobs, reinforcing Ramsay’s commitment to large‑scale investment in the City of London. And Ramsay has also partnered with the Clermont Hotel Group to open the UK’s first Hell’s Kitchen restaurant at the Cumberland Hotel in London’s Marble Arch, expected spring 2026.

Gordon Ramsay has also partnered with Formula 1 to create “Ramsay’s Garage” a luxury trackside hospitality experience. Located in the pit lane, it features high-end, bespoke menus curated by Ramsay for select 2026 Grand Prix events all over the world.
